the FAQ on on alexanderarms.com says that the Beowulf uppers will fit ar-15 type lowers.  So this means I can just hook the two together and go?

I just wanna make sure I have this right before I only get an upper and talk my brother in law in to letting me use his AR :)
Link Posted: 12/8/2005 4:26:37 AM EDT
[#1]
yep, even uses the same mags in most cases.
